The CMF functions in keyshot are ‘built’ using the “Material Information Manager” (Tools>Material Tools>Material Information Manager - or Tools Button>Material Information Manager). To use this method it requires a lot of organization, and quite a bit of setup. If you will be using any common sets of materials, especially across files, this could be amazingly useful.
